Description

Rice is a widely consumed crop around the world that has tremendous importance and is cultivated almost everywhere except Antarctica.

However, various biotic and abiotic stresses have a negative effect on rice cultivation, seriously reducing its yield.

This volume examines the bacterial and fungal pathogens that cause rice diseases and explores how to manage these diseases.

It covers the economic and environmental impact of rice fungal diseases on global food security and proceeds to delve into diagnostic methods for rice fungal pathogen detection and discusses current strategic and applied biotechnological methods for the effective management of rice fungal diseases.
